Abstract

The utility model discloses a kind of spray equipments applied to forming machine, it is related to the technical field of textile printing and dyeing, including cloth feeding bracket, the spray equipment includes the spray waterpipe being arranged on cloth feeding bracket, the water pump connecting with spray waterpipe pipeline, the water tank connecting with the pipeline of water pump, and the catch basin below spray waterpipe is set, the spray waterpipe lower end is provided with several water jets, is provided with nozzle in water jet;Regulating mechanism is provided on the spray waterpipe, the regulating mechanism includes the sliding groove that the middle part of spray waterpipe outer surface is arranged in, there are two arc-shaped sliding shoes for connection on the sliding slot, sealant are provided between the sliding shoe and spray waterpipe, the sealant is located at the underface of nozzle.By the regulating mechanism being arranged on spray waterpipe, change the spray range of spray waterpipe with the width of cloth, to reach reduction water resource waste.

Technical field
The utility model relates to the technical fields of printing and dyeing textile equipment, more specifically, it relates to which a kind of be applied to sizing The spray equipment of machine.
Background technique
Forming machine be it is a kind of by cloth flatten equipment, cloth in process of production by dyeing, embathe and etc. after, cloth More fold is generally had on material, so cloth, in the process of last machine-shaping, cloth needs to pass through cloth setting machine Cloth is become relatively flat.To improve fixed effect, cloth needs when patterning process in moist state pair in forming machine Sizing is dried in printed textile, to change the institutional framework of printed textile, guarantees that the shaping of printed textile is smooth.
Currently, to disclose a kind of printed textile for being equipped with humidifier fixed for the Chinese patent that bulletin is CN205347782U Type machine, including forming machine, installation settings has humidifier in the selvage guide roller frame of forming machine, and installation settings has spray disk in humidifier, Spray disk is revolved by pulley apparatus with the spray coil motor transmission connection being mounted in selvage guide roller frame with the revolving speed high speed of 5200r/min Turn, spray disk is connect by first filter with the water pump in sink, and spray coil motor, water pump and control cabinet electricly connect, control cabinet It is mounted in selvage guide roller frame.
Above-mentioned utility model will carry out humidification process to printed textile by the mode of manual humidification originally and change into machinery Automatic humidification greatly improves the sizing quality of printed textile.But the width and thin and thick due to cloth can become, and show The spray flow of some humidifiers is fixed and invariable.When cloth width narrows, the range that humidifier sprays is constant, leads Causing the water of the nozzle close to machine edge can be sprayed directly on in equipment, cause water resource waste.

Referring to Fig.1, a kind of spray equipment applied to forming machine is provided with the cloth feeding that conveying cloth enters at rack cloth feeding Bracket 100, spray equipment are arranged on cloth feeding bracket 100.Spray equipment includes being arranged on cloth feeding bracket 100 to be used to spray The spray waterpipe 200 of water, the water pump 300 being connect with 200 pipeline of spray waterpipe, the water tank 400 being connect with 300 pipeline of water pump, And it is arranged in below spray waterpipe 200 for recycling the catch basin 500 of water resource.Cloth is from quilt on cloth feeding bracket 100 After introducing, the water in water tank 400 is drawn into spray tube water pipe by water pump 300, and the water being extracted up passes through spray waterpipe 200 eject water on cloth, realize the automatic humidification function to cloth.Spray to improve spray waterpipe in the present embodiment Uniformity, the middle of spray waterpipe 200 is arranged in the pipeline that spray waterpipe 200 connects water pump 300, and is located at spray waterpipe 200 surface.
Referring to Figure 1 and Figure 3, spray waterpipe 200 is evenly arranged with several water jets 210 close to the one end on ground, and sprays water Spray nozzle for spraying water 211 is provided in mouth 210, nozzle 211, which can be realized, will be flowed into water jet 210 only one water change It is sprayed for misty water, improves the range and effect of spray, improve humidifying effect, keep the humidification to cloth more uniform.
Referring to Fig. 2 and Fig. 3, it is additionally provided with regulating mechanism on spray waterpipe 200, regulating mechanism includes along spray waterpipe 200 It is axially disposed within the sliding groove 220 of 200 outer surface of spray waterpipe, connects and be arranged in spray waterpipe 200 with the sliding of sliding groove 220 Two arc-shaped sliding shoes 230 at both ends, and the sealant 240 being arranged between sliding shoe 230 and spray waterpipe 200.It is sliding Motion block 230 divides for two parts, a part of locating piece for sliding motion is matched and can done with sliding groove 220 with sliding groove 220 231, another part is the circular arc block 232 to match with 200 external surface shape of spray waterpipe, locating piece 231 and circular arc block 232 1 Body setting.The slightly long depth with sliding groove 220 of the length of locating piece 231, makes to produce between sliding shoe 230 and spray waterpipe 200 A raw cavity, sealant 240 are arranged in cavity, can do sliding motion with spray waterpipe 200.And sealant 240 is located at spray The underface of mouth 211 is connect with 230 gluing of sliding shoe, and 240 material of sealant is selected as rubber in this implementation power.
Threaded hole is offered on side wall of the sliding shoe 230 far from ground, bolt 250 passes through threaded hole and spray waterpipe 200 abut against, to fixed sliding shoe 230.
Referring to 4 and Fig. 5, catch basin 500 is arranged below spray waterpipe 200, and fixes with cloth feeding bracket 100 to connect. The side of close end is provided with discharge outlet 510 in 500 bottom of catch basin, pipeline is fixed between discharge outlet 510 and water tank 400 Connection.The water collected in catch basin 500 that makes to drop down is flowed into water tank 400 by discharge outlet 510, realizes to injection The recycling of extra water reduces the waste of water resource.And there is a deflector 520(being obliquely installed as schemed in catch basin 500 Shown in 1), discharge outlet 510 is set to 520 lowest position of deflector, and 520 other end of deflector is fixedly connected on far from discharge outlet On 510 500 side wall of catch basin.Allow the water flow being dropped in catch basin 500 by fast guiding into discharge outlet 510, It is transported in water tank 400 and is recycled, improve the efficiency of entire recovery system.Use is additionally provided in discharge outlet 510 In the filter screen 530 of impurity screening and cloth villus, the clean degree of recycle-water is improved.
Referring to Fig.1 and Fig. 6, cloth feeding bracket 100 are provided with water squeezing sector along cloth conveying direction, and water squeezing sector includes along cloth The support frame 600 and support frame 600 that material transmission direction is arranged in 100 both ends of cloth feeding bracket and is fixedly connected with cloth feeding bracket 100 The second fabric guide roll 650 being fixedly connected, and the first fabric guide roll 640 being slidably connected with support frame 600.It is opened on support frame 600 Equipped with regulating tank 610, it is provided with the adjusting block 620 with the rotation connection of 640 bearing 641 of the first fabric guide roll in regulating tank 610, adjusts Block 620 can drive the first fabric guide roll 640 to do the movement close to or far from the second fabric guide roll 650 along 610 axial direction of regulating tank. It is provided with the limited block 612 parallel with cloth transporting direction on 610 side wall of regulating tank inside support frame 600, in adjusting block Limiting slot 621, and section of the cross sectional shape of limiting slot 621 and limited block 612 are provided on 620 faces opposite with limited block 612 Face shape is agreed with.
Referring to figure 6 and figure 7, the lead screw being fixedly connected with adjusting block 620 is provided with far from the one end on ground in adjusting block 620 631, the upper end of lead screw 631 passes through support frame 600 far from the through-hole 632 on the face of ground one end, and rotation is provided in through-hole 632 Lantern ring 633, rotational lantern ring 633 are threadedly coupled with lead screw 631, and the length of rotational lantern ring 633 is greater than the depth of through-hole 632.? Restraining position ring block 634 is all arranged in the both ends of rotational lantern ring 633, and stop collar 634 extends outward from the outer wall of rotational lantern ring 633, limit The effect of position ring 634 is that so that it will not fall from fixed frame by the axial restraint of lantern ring.Positioned at 600 outer end of support frame The upper end of stop collar 634 has also been wholely set adjusting nut 635, realizes rotational lantern ring 633 by the rotation to adjusting nut 635 Rotation, to drive moving up and down for lead screw 631, the screw thread inside adjusting nut 635 and 633 internal whorl one of rotational lantern ring Body setting.
It is also arranged with tensioning spring 636 in the outside of lead screw 631,636 one end of tensioning spring and regulating tank 610 are far from ground An end face be fixedly connected, the other end is fixedly connected with 620 upper surface of adjusting block.After placing tensioning spring 636, tensioning spring 636 be compressive state, when tensioning spring 636 can generate the active force for making spring revert to nature, by 633 He of rotational lantern ring Lead screw 631 fits closely the frictional force increased together between the two, and rotational lantern ring 633 is made to be not susceptible to rotate, and improves lead screw 631 high stability, opposite 640 stability of the first fabric guide roll also improve.
The rotational lantern ring 633 being threadedly coupled on support frame 600 with lead screw 631, the regulating tank slid for adjusting block 620 610, the tensioning spring 636 that both ends are connected to respectively on 600 inner wall of support frame and slipping block is constituted for fixing lead screw 631 Locating piece 630.By cooperating between support frame 600 and locating piece 630, the fixation to adjusting block 620 is realized, thus by first Fabric guide roll 640 is fixed on work feed bracket 100, and the movement of position will not occur for the first fabric guide roll 640 in process, is promoted The stability of first fabric guide roll 640, convenient for the operation of equipment.
The course of work:
After cloth is introduced into from cloth feeding bracket 100, the water in water tank 400 is drawn into spray tube water pipe by water pump 300 In, the water being extracted up passes through the nozzle 211 being arranged on spray waterpipe 200 and ejects water on cloth, realizes to cloth Automatic humidification function, the water dripped on the extra water and cloth of injection can be arranged on catchmenting for 200 lower section of spray waterpipe Slot 500 is recycled.
When cloth width becomes smaller, the sliding shoe 230 that 200 both ends of spray waterpipe are arranged in is done to 200 edge of spray waterpipe Central axes in cloth transmission direction block up the sealant 240 for the underface that nozzle 211 is arranged in by nozzle 211 close to movement Firmly, tightening bolt 250 abuts against 250 bottom of bolt with 200 outer surface of spray waterpipe, prevents sliding shoe 230 from being slided.It is real Show the control to the unlatching quantity of water jet 210, can be according to the width of printing and dyeing fabrics come adjusting slider position, closing is not required to The water jet 210 wanted, has saved water resource.
Cloth after shower humidification enters the gap between the first fabric guide roll 640 and the second fabric guide roll 650, by cloth In extra moisture squeeze out, to improve the fixed effect of cloth.The excessive moisture of extrusion collects in catch basin 500, by setting It sets in the discharge outlet 510 in catch basin 500 by moisture conveying into water tank 400, carries out in secondary utilization.
When cloth thickness, the adjusting nut 635 on rotational lantern ring 633 is rotated with spanner, since rotational lantern ring 633 is by axial direction Be fixed on support frame 600, so the axial position of rotational lantern ring 633 will not change during rotation, lead screw 631 by It is moved up and down under the action of the internal screw thread of rotational lantern ring 633.Limiting slot 621 on adjusting block 620 is by limited block 612 Limit, so adjusting block 620 only occurs in the sliding of vertical direction in regulating tank 610, thus drive lead screw 631 on move down It is dynamic, change the distance between the first fabric guide roll 640 and the second fabric guide roll 650, prevents cloth from damaging.
